So i Joined Open Web Gold a couple of days ago. I download a lot of torrents and to be honest the performance that i have experienced had been below par. After hours has been good, but during the day has been terrible!
For example today i have managed to download only 82mb.... at roughly 16kB/s average with the max speed being 32kB/s for a short period of time. For a "Gold" account i feel this is terrible. I have a 2mb uncapped account.

Has anyone else had these issues or have a solution to this?

Are you downloading torrents during the day or just normal usage? Torrents will be shaped during the day. If you want to download torrents at full throttle during the day you'll have to fork out for a unshaped account.
 
Got the gold leon edition account, i do realise that torrents are normally shaped during the day, my problem is the extent that the shaping is taking place.
 
Got the gold leon edition account, i do realise that torrents are normally shaped during the day, my problem is the extent that the shaping is taking place.

You can contact their support and maybe they can do something about it but I doubt it. While being great accounts (the Gold), they are still shaped consumer accounts and trying to download torrents during business hours is just not going to fly. Rather schedule all your torrent downloads to happen after hours and you shouldn't have any issues.
